Transaction 8996389c0a3efe8aba3971717d42a017c6d57b86cfe862462adba1d02b6bf9d9
1 Input
1 Output
-
8996389c0a3efe8aba3971717d42a017c6d57b86cfe862462adba1d02b6bf9d9:0
- value
- 9317361
- script pubkey
- OP_0 OP_PUSHBYTES_20 3131c1fc6d337274f7f3a637350317b5c8a0b4d3
- address
- bc1qxycurlrdxde8faln5cmn2qchkhy2pdxne6r2lt